extend/os/linux/keg_relocate: restore checking only GCC major versions

This commit is contained in:
Bo Anderson 2022-04-22 01:41:23 +01:00
parent b2a896eec6
commit 6db3ee6b0a
No known key found for this signature in database
GPG Key ID: 3DB94E204E137D65

View File

@ -92,7 +92,7 @@ class Keg
preferred_gcc_version = gcc.version
end
if !Homebrew::EnvConfig.simulate_macos_on_linux? &&
DevelopmentTools.non_apple_gcc_version("gcc") < preferred_gcc_version
DevelopmentTools.non_apple_gcc_version("gcc") < preferred_gcc_version.major
gcc = Formulary.factory(CompilerSelector.preferred_gcc) if Homebrew::EnvConfig.install_from_api?
formulae += gcc.recursive_dependencies.map(&:name)
formulae << gcc.name